Understanding The Basics Of 165Hz
Before we dive into the process of enabling 165Hz on your Asus monitor, let’s first understand what 165Hz is and how it works. The refresh rate of a monitor refers to the number of times the display is updated per second. A higher refresh rate means a smoother and more responsive display. 165Hz is a relatively high refresh rate that is ideal for gaming, video editing, and other applications that require fast motion rendering.

Method 2: Using The Graphics Card Control Panel
If your Asus monitor doesn’t have an OSD or if you prefer to use the graphics card control panel, you can enable 165Hz through the NVIDIA Control Panel (for NVIDIA graphics cards) or the AMD Radeon Settings (for AMD graphics cards).
- Open the NVIDIA Control Panel or AMD Radeon Settings
- Navigate to the “Display” or “Monitor” section
- Select the monitor that you want to enable 165Hz for
- Click on the “Refresh Rate” dropdown menu and select “165Hz”
- Save the changes and exit the control panel

Common Issues And Solutions
Enabling 165Hz on your Asus monitor can sometimes be tricky, and you may encounter some issues along the way. Here are some common issues and solutions:
-
My Monitor Is Not Recognizing The 165Hz Signal
If your monitor is not recognizing the 165Hz signal, make sure that your graphics card is capable of delivering a 165Hz signal and that the monitor cable is securely connected.
-
I’m Getting Screen Tearing Or Stuttering
If you’re getting screen tearing or stuttering, try enabling the G-Sync or FreeSync technology on your monitor to reduce screen tearing and stuttering.
-
I’m Getting A Warning Message Saying That 165Hz Is Not Supported
If you’re getting a warning message saying that 165Hz is not supported, make sure that your monitor is capable of 165Hz and that the monitor cable is securely connected. You can also try updating your graphics card drivers to the latest version.

What Type Of Cable Connection Do I Need To Use To Enable 165Hz On My Asus Monitor?
To enable 165Hz on your Asus monitor, you’ll need to use a compatible cable connection that can support the required bandwidth. The most common cable connection options for 165Hz include DisplayPort 1.4 and 1.2, as well as HDMI 2.0. Using a lower version of either cable connection may result in a reduced refresh rate.
It’s essential to note that the USB-C cable connection also supports the Alt Mode with DisplayPort 1.4, allowing it to enable 165Hz on supported Asus monitors. Additionally, some monitors may not support 165Hz on all available ports. Check your Asus monitor specifications for details on the cable connection options available for 165Hz.
How Do I Enable 165Hz On My Asus Monitor In The Display Settings?
To enable 165Hz on your Asus monitor in the display settings, navigate to your graphics control panel or display settings. Open the ‘Display Settings’ or ‘Graphics Options’ menu on your PC or gaming console, and look for the ‘Refresh Rate’ or ‘Monitor Settings’ option. Within this menu, choose the 165Hz setting from the available options, then save the changes to apply the new refresh rate.
Some devices or monitors may have an ‘Auto’ or ‘Optimize’ option for refresh rate settings, which detects the optimal refresh rate. Be cautious not to set it to this, as this may revert the refresh rate back to a lower value like 60Hz, overriding the enabled 165Hz setting.
